This eBook is a practical, research-informed guide exploring how thoughts, beliefs, stress responses, and daily habits shape both mental and physical well-being. Rather than presenting positive thinking as a cure-all, the book grounds its claims in real science, showing how mindset influences the body's natural systems for stress regulation, recovery, and resilience. Across ten focused chapters, readers move from foundational concepts—like the difference between a growth and fixed mindset—into deeper territory: how a person's stress mindset changes physiological outcomes, why optimism is linked to longevity, and how expectations drive the placebo effect. The book then turns practical, offering concrete strategies for building healthier mindset habits and breaking free from negative thought patterns that quietly undermine well-being. Closing chapters look toward emerging research in mind-body medicine and offer a roadmap for sustaining positive change over a lifetime. Written in accessible language and clearly framed as a complement to—not a replacement for—professional medical and psychological care, this guide is ideal for readers seeking an evidence-based understanding of how their inner life shapes their outer health, and practical tools to make that connection work in their favor.
